Morphological NotesConjunction וְ + Qal perfect 2ms with vav-consecutive (HC/Vqq2ms). Sequential form commonly expressing future or consequential action: "and you shall walk." Addressed to a masculine singular subject.
Rendering RationaleThe verb is Qal with prefixed conjunction (vav-consecutive) and second masculine singular form, indicating sequential action directed to one male addressee: "and you shall walk." The rendering preserves the root sense of physical movement that often extends to one’s manner of life or conduct.
